#d47832 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d47832 is composed of 83.1% red, 47.1%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.4% magenta, 76.4%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 25.9 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 51.4%. #d47832 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ff064 with #a90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#d47832
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060301 is the darkest color, while #fdf8f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d47832
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#88827e is the less saturated color, while #fa730c is the most saturated one.
